The Duke and Duchess of Cambridge aren’t known for their public displays of affection, unlike Prince Harry and Meghan Markle.

So, when Prince William and the former Kate Middleton were pictured holding hands in St. George’s Chapel in Windsor Castle before Friday’s royal wedding between Princess Eugenie of York and Jack Brooksbank, it inevitably set Twitter alight.
